What is Firefighter Expense Form
The Firefighter Expense Statement is an expense report form used by firefighters to document and report work-related expenses for tax deductions.

What is the Firefighter Expense Statement?
The Firefighter Expense Statement is a crucial tool for firefighters, helping them accurately report and document various work-related expenses. This form plays an essential role in ensuring that firefighters can claim the appropriate deductions. The statement includes multiple sections, each designed to capture specific types of expenses incurred during their duties.
Accurate reporting of expenses is vital, as it can significantly impact a firefighter's tax filings. Ensuring all expenses are documented correctly not only supports claims for deductions but also aids in personal financial management.
Purpose and Benefits of Completing the Firefighter Expense Form
Completing the Firefighter Expense Form allows firefighters to detail and document their work-related expenses effectively. One of the primary benefits is the potential to maximize deductions, which can help minimize tax liabilities. This is particularly advantageous when claiming items such as uniforms and equipment that are necessary for their roles.
Using this form facilitates streamlined record-keeping for personal and tax purposes, ensuring all pertinent expenses are accounted for and easily retrievable during tax season.
Who Needs the Firefighter Expense Statement?
The Firefighter Expense Statement is essential for both active and retired firefighters. Each role within the firefighting profession can find the statement relevant, from firefighters on duty to retirees managing their post-career finances.
In particular, scenarios such as uniform purchases, training costs, and travel for incident responses necessitate the completion of this form. Identifying and recording these professional expenses can significantly benefit firefighters in claiming deductions.
Key Features of the Firefighter Expense Statement
This document highlights several key sections essential for accurately reporting expenses. Specific fields include those dedicated to uniform, travel, and vehicle expenses, as well as other miscellaneous costs related to firefighting duties.

Who is eligible to use the Firefighter Expense Statement?
Eligibility to use the Firefighter Expense Statement includes active firefighters who incur work-related expenses not reimbursed by their employer.
What is the deadline for submitting this form?
The Firefighter Expense Statement should be submitted by tax filing deadlines to ensure that deductions are processed promptly for the tax year.
How can I submit the completed Firefighter Expense Statement?
You can submit the completed Firefighter Expense Statement through your department or to your tax professional if required, ensuring you follow any specific submission guidelines.
What supporting documents are needed when filing this statement?
When filing the Firefighter Expense Statement, it's crucial to include receipts, mileage logs, and any other documentation that supports your reported expenses.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es to avoid include entering incorrect expense amounts, omitting necessary details, and failing to keep supporting documents that validate your claims.
